Dear Mr. Kirkland:
On February 3, 2012, the Division of Water Quality (DTQ) received your application dated January 27, 2012
to impact, 180 square feet (W) of Zone I protected riparian buffers and 120 square feet (ft2) of Zone 2 protected
riparian buffers for the purpose of accessing a pier system. IOW Q has determined through correspondence with
the Division of Coastal Management (DCM) that the project was permitted through the DCM General Permit
Process and the Neuse River Riparian Buffer impacts were approved through the Memorandum of
Understanding (MOU) between DWQ and DCM. Therefore, we are returning your application package and
withdrawing your request. Please continue to follow the conditions of the GP and the Buffer Authorization for
Piers & Docks (enclosed).
